Current Rating and Its Significance
MarketsMOJO's 'Sell' rating on Wanbury Ltd indicates a cautious stance for investors, suggesting that the stock may underperform relative to the broader market or its sector peers in the near to medium term. This rating was assigned on 10 Nov 2025, when the Mojo Score declined from 54 (Hold) to 43 (Sell), reflecting a notable deterioration in the stock's overall assessment. Investors should understand that this rating is based on a comprehensive evaluation of multiple factors, including quality, valuation, financial trends, and technical indicators, all of which are crucial for making informed investment decisions.
Here's How Wanbury Ltd Looks Today
As of 12 January 2026, Wanbury Ltd remains a microcap player in the Pharmaceuticals & Biotechnology sector. The latest data shows the stock has experienced a downward trend, with a one-day price change of -1.99%, a one-month decline of -10.01%, and a one-year return of -10.59%. This underperformance contrasts with the broader BSE500 index, which has delivered a positive 6.66% return over the same one-year period, highlighting Wanbury's relative weakness in the current market environment.
Quality Assessment
The company's quality grade is assessed as average. Wanbury Ltd has demonstrated moderate growth in net sales, with a compound annual growth rate of 14.01% over the past five years. However, this growth has not translated into robust long-term performance, partly due to the company's high leverage. The average debt-to-equity ratio stands at 3.36 times, indicating significant reliance on debt financing, which raises concerns about financial stability and risk exposure, especially in volatile market conditions.
Valuation Perspective
From a valuation standpoint, Wanbury Ltd is currently considered attractive. This suggests that the stock's price relative to its earnings, book value, or other fundamental metrics may offer potential value opportunities for investors willing to accept the associated risks. Nevertheless, valuation attractiveness alone does not guarantee positive returns, particularly when other factors such as financial health and market sentiment are unfavourable.
Financial Trend Analysis
The financial grade for Wanbury Ltd is positive, reflecting some encouraging aspects in the company's recent financial performance. Despite the high debt levels, the company has maintained operational metrics that support a constructive outlook on its financial trajectory. However, investors should remain cautious given the elevated debt burden and the implications it has for cash flow and interest obligations.
Technical Outlook
Technically, the stock is rated bearish. The downward momentum is evident in the stock's price performance, with consistent declines over multiple time frames. Additionally, the high proportion of promoter shares pledged—currently at 86.67%, having increased by 9.93% over the last quarter—adds to the technical pressure. In falling markets, such high pledged shareholding can exacerbate selling pressure, as promoters may be forced to liquidate holdings to meet margin calls, further weighing on the stock price.
Risks and Market Position
Wanbury Ltd's high debt and significant promoter pledge levels represent key risks for investors. The company's underperformance relative to the broader market over the past year underscores these concerns. While the pharmaceutical sector can offer defensive qualities, Wanbury's financial structure and technical signals suggest caution. Investors should weigh these factors carefully against their risk tolerance and investment horizon.
Momentum just kicked in! This Small Cap from the Auto - Trucks sector entered our list with explosive short-term signals. Catch the wave while it's still building!
- - Fresh momentum detected
- - Explosive short-term signals
- - Early wave positioning
Investor Takeaway
For investors, the 'Sell' rating on Wanbury Ltd signals a recommendation to consider reducing exposure or avoiding new purchases at this time. The combination of average quality, attractive valuation, positive financial trends, but bearish technicals and high leverage creates a complex risk-reward profile. The stock's recent underperformance relative to the market and the elevated promoter pledge levels further reinforce the need for caution.
Investors seeking opportunities in the Pharmaceuticals & Biotechnology sector may wish to monitor Wanbury Ltd closely for any improvements in its financial health or technical indicators before reconsidering a position. Meanwhile, the current rating reflects a prudent approach based on the company's present fundamentals and market conditions.
Summary of Key Metrics as of 12 January 2026
- Mojo Score: 43.0 (Sell)
- Market Capitalisation: Microcap
- Debt to Equity Ratio (average): 3.36 times
- Promoter Shares Pledged: 86.67% (up 9.93% last quarter)
- Returns: 1 Day -1.99%, 1 Month -10.01%, 1 Year -10.59%
- BSE500 1 Year Return: +6.66%
These figures illustrate the challenges Wanbury Ltd faces in the current market environment and underpin the rationale behind the 'Sell' rating.
Looking Ahead
While the pharmaceutical sector often benefits from steady demand and innovation-driven growth, Wanbury Ltd's financial and technical profile suggests that investors should remain vigilant. Monitoring debt reduction efforts, promoter pledge levels, and any shifts in technical momentum will be critical in assessing future investment potential.
In conclusion, the 'Sell' rating by MarketsMOJO, last updated on 10 Nov 2025, remains appropriate given the stock's current fundamentals and market dynamics as of 12 January 2026. Investors should carefully consider these factors in the context of their portfolios and investment strategies.
Upgrade at special rates, valid only for the next few days. Claim Your Special Rate →
